POSITION SUMMARY & KEY AREAS OF RESPONSIBILITY:
Primary responsibility is to ensure high quality software solutions as a contributing member of a highly motivated team of Engineers. This individual will serve the SW Quality Engineer role on an Agile team.
Responsibilities include but not limited to:
Plan and Conduct testing of NCRs product software systems subsystems and components
Apply test methodology processes procedures standards and tools used by team.
Exhibit a good understanding of Software Development and Quality Assurance best practices
Coordinate crossteam test activities
Experience in writing Test Automation Scripts and Test Automation Keywords
Perform manual functional and regression testing
Perform volume performance reliability testing either Manually or Using Tools and Scripts
Ensure high quality software which meets requirements make sure every feature has clearly defined acceptance criteria and is well tested using documented test scripts. Full test coverage against requirements is expected
Record maintain and archive test results
Conduct tests ranging from hardware component level to the full solution
Install and configure test environment including hardware and software components
Design and develop test scripts which facilitate reuse of test scripts and components
Record and track all issues uncovered during requirements review or testing and follow through to resolution. Utilize software based system maintenance and tracking tools for test cases and defects
Create accurate estimates of work efforts and meet project deadlines
Assist others in estimating task effort and dependencies responsible for team commitments within the Sprint.
Monitor test execution progress and provide metrics and reports to management
Manage physical and virtual lab environments
Applies good debugging and troubleshoot techniques to assist Developers with isolating the problem and determining the solution
Review and provide input for technical documentation user help materials and customer training
Stays current with technology and/or test practices and disseminates knowledge to team members forms best practices
